副詞
- 1. 向船外,(自船上)落水 A girl slipped and fell overboard. 一個姑娘從船上失足落水。
形容詞
- 1. 【美】【口】非常熱心的,全身心投入的 He's overboard for the new TV series. 他對新的電視連續劇著了迷。
- 拋棄某事物; 除掉或不再支持某人 After heavily losing the election the party threw their leader overboard. 該黨慘敗落選後罷免了黨魁。
